JavaScript实现将数组数据添加到Select下拉框的方法

阅读时长 3 分钟读完

在前端开发中,我们经常需要将一组数据展示在下拉框中供用户选择。本文将介绍如何使用JavaScript将数组数据添加到Select下拉框中。

实现步骤

  1. 获取Select元素:首先需要获取需要添加选项的Select元素,可以通过document.getElementById()方法获取。

  2. 创建Option元素:对于每一个数据项,需要创建一个对应的Option元素。可以使用document.createElement()方法创建一个Option元素,并设置其value和textContent属性。

  3. 将Option元素添加到Select元素中:将创建的Option元素添加到Select元素的子元素列表中,可以使用selectElement.appendChild()方法。

  4. 使用循环批量添加Option元素:如果有多个数据项需要添加,可以使用for循环来批量创建并添加Option元素。

    -- -------------------- ---- -------
    ----- ---- - -
      - ------ ---- ----- ----- --
      - ------ ---- ----- ----- --
      - ------ ---- ----- ----- -
    --
    --- ---- - - -- - - ------------ ---- -
      ----- ------------- - ---------------------------------
      ------------------- - --------------
      ------------------------- - -------------
      -----------------------------------------
    -

示例代码

HTML代码:

JavaScript代码:

-- -------------------- ---- -------
----- ------------- - ------------------------------------
----- ---- - -
  - ------ ---- ----- ----- --
  - ------ ---- ----- ----- --
  - ------ ---- ----- ----- -
--
--- ---- - - -- - - ------------ ---- -
  ----- ------------- - ---------------------------------
  ------------------- - --------------
  ------------------------- - -------------
  -----------------------------------------
-

总结

本文介绍了使用JavaScript将数组数据添加到Select下拉框中的方法,包括获取Select元素、创建Option元素、将Option元素添加到Select元素中以及使用循环批量添加Option元素。这是前端开发中非常基础和常见的操作,对于初学者来说具有一定的指导意义。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/4038

纠错
反馈